Understanding Low Carb Bowl Recipes:
Low carb bowl recipes are essentially meals served in a bowl that are low in carbohydrates and high in essential nutrients. They typically consist of a base ingredient, such as cauliflower rice, quinoa, or zucchini noodles, topped with a variety of proteins, vegetables, and flavorful dressings or sauces. These recipes have gained popularity due to their versatility, convenience, and ability to cater to different dietary needs, including gluten-free, paleo, and keto.

- Asian Chicken Cauliflower Rice Bowl:
Ingredients:
- Cooked chicken breast
- Cauliflower rice
- Mixed vegetables (carrots, peas, bell peppers)
- Soy sauce
- Sesame oil
- Garlic and ginger paste
- Green onions for garnish
Instructions:
- Heat a non-stick pan and add a small amount of sesame oil.
- Add the garlic and ginger paste and sauté for a minute.
- Add the mixed vegetables and cook until they are tender.
- Stir in the cooked chicken breast and cauliflower rice.
- Season with soy sauce and cook for another few minutes.
- Garnish with chopped green onions before serving.
Health benefits:
This low carb bowl recipe is packed with lean protein from the chicken breast and essential nutrients from the mixed vegetables. Cauliflower rice serves as a low carb alternative to traditional rice, reducing calorie intake and aiding in weight management.
- Greek Salad Quinoa Bowl:
Ingredients:
- Cooked quinoa
- Cherry tomatoes
- Cucumber
- Red onion
- Kalamata olives
- Feta cheese
- Olive oil
- Lemon juice
- Dried o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- In a bowl, combine cooked quinoa, cherry tomatoes, cucumber, red onion, and Kalamata olives.
- In a separate bowl, mix olive oil, lemon juice, dried oregano, salt, and pepper to make the dressing.
- Pour the dressing over the quinoa and vegetable mixture.
- Toss well to combine.
- Crumble feta cheese on top before serving.
Health benefits:
This Greek-inspired low carb bowl recipe is rich in antioxidants from the vegetables, healthy fats from the olives and olive oil, and protein from the quinoa and feta cheese. It provides a satisfying and nutritious meal option.
- Mexican Beef Taco Bowl:
Ingredients:
- Lean ground beef
- Taco seasoning
- Lettuce
- Avocado
- Cherry tomatoes
- Red onion
- Black beans
- Salsa
- Greek yogurt (optional)
- Tortilla chips (optional)
Instructions:
- In a pan, cook lean ground beef and taco seasoning until browned and cooked through.
- In a bowl, layer lettuce as the base.
- Top with cooked ground beef, avocado slices, cherry tomatoes, red onion, and black beans.
- Drizzle salsa over the bowl.
- Optional toppings: dollop of Greek yogurt and crushed tortilla chips.
Health benefits:
This Mexican-inspired low carb bowl recipe offers a balance of protein, healthy fats, and fiber. It is a satisfying and flavorful option for those seeking a low carb alternative to traditional tacos.
- Mediterranean Shrimp Zucchini Noodle Bowl:
Ingredients:
- Shrimp
- Zucchini
- Cherry tomatoes
- Kalamata olives
- Feta cheese
- Olive oil
- Lemon juice
- Fresh basil
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- In a pan, sauté shrimp with olive oil, lemon juice, salt, and pepper until cooked.
- Using a spiralizer, create zucchini noodles.
- In a bowl, combine zucchini noodles, cherry tomatoes, Kalamata olives, and cooked shrimp.
- Drizzle olive oil and lemon juice over the bowl.
- Garnish with fresh basil and crumbled feta cheese.
Health benefits:
This Mediterranean-inspired low carb bowl recipe is rich in omega-3 fatty acids from shrimp, antioxidants from cherry tomatoes and olives, and calcium from feta cheese. It provides a light and refreshing option for a low carb meal.
- BBQ Chicken Sweet Potato Bowl:
Ingredients:
- Grilled chicken breast
- Sweet potato
- Broccoli
- Red bell pepper
- BBQ sauce
- Ol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Slice sweet potato into cubes and toss with olive oil, salt, and pepper.
- Place sweet potato cubes on a baking sheet and roast for 20-25 minutes until tender.
- In a pan, sauté broccoli and red bell pepper with olive oil until cooked.
- In a bowl, layer grilled chicken breast, roasted sweet potato, and sautéed vegetables.
- Drizzle BBQ sauce over the bowl.
Health benefits:
This BBQ chicken sweet potato bowl offers a balance of protein, complex carbohydrates, and fiber. Sweet potatoes are a nutritious alternative to regular potatoes, and the BBQ sauce adds a flavorful twist.
Tips for Creating Your Own Low Carb Bowl Recipes:
-
Choose low carb base ingredients:
Opt for alternatives to traditional rice or pasta such as cauliflower rice, quinoa, or zucchini noodles. -
Incorporate lean proteins:
Include grilled chicken, shrimp, tofu, or lean beef to add protein and satiety to your bowl. -
Add a variety of vegetables:
Load your bowl with colorful vegetables like cherry tomatoes, bell peppers, cucumbers, and leafy greens. -
Use flavorful dressings and sauces:
Experiment with homemade dressings using olive oil, lemon juice, herbs, and spices. Opt for low sugar and low carb sauces. -
Experiment with different flavors and textures:
Combine ingredients that complement each other in terms of taste, texture, and visual appeal. Add nuts, seeds, or fresh herbs for added crunch and flavor.
